Why pest control matters in Orange County

California has some of the strictest pest control regulations in the country, and Orange County's climate supports year-round activity for ants, roaches, drywood termites, and rats. We use IPM — meaning we identify and exclude the source before reaching for chemistry — which means fewer chemicals and more long-term control around your home, family, and landscaping.

Our technicians are licensed under California Structural Pest Control Board License #PR8662 and apply products in accordance with all California Department of Pesticide Regulation requirements. Re-entry intervals are discussed with you before any treatment.

We default to IPM — identify, exclude, and physically remove harborage before treating with chemistry. When stronger residuals are warranted, we apply per the product label and California Department of Pesticide Regulation requirements, and we discuss re-entry intervals with you up front.
Yes — we tent-fumigate with Vikane (sulfuryl fluoride) when spot treatment is not adequate. We coordinate access, plant protection, and re-entry per California regulations.
No. We offer one-time treatments and no-contract recurring service. Cancel anytime, no fees.
Yes — when termite treatment we performed (or coordinated) clears the original Section 1 findings, we issue clearance documentation directly to your escrow officer.
